BEIJING 1 (TSINGHUA) is classified as:


NORAD ID: 28890
Int'l Code: 2005-043A
Perigee: 682.5 km
Apogee: 703.4 km
Inclination: 98.2 °
Period: 98.5 minutes
Semi major axis: 7063 km
RCS: 0.337 m2 (medium)
Launch date: October 27, 2005
Source: People's Republic of China (PRC)
Launch site: PLESETSK MISSILE AND SPACE COMPLEX (PKMTR)

Earth observation for Disaster Monitoring Constellation (DMC); also research.
